5 Steps to Write an Awesome Email

You’ve probably heard about email marketing before, but have you ever wondered what makes one email better than another? In this article, we’ll show you five things you should consider when writing an awesome email. Email marketing has become a popular way for businesses to connect with customers and prospects. But how do you write an effective email that will get people to click on your link and read your message? We’ll show you five things to keep in mind when crafting your next email campaign.

Know who you’re writing to

First, you need to know who you’re writing to. This means knowing your customer’s name, job title, company size, industry, and more. It also means understanding your reader’s needs and interests so you can tailor your messages appropriately.

Be clear about the purpose of your message

Second, make sure your message has a clear purpose. If you’re sending out an email newsletter, you might want to send out a reminder about upcoming events or a new product launch. Or maybe you’re trying to sell something online, such as a service or a product. Whatever the case, make sure your message clearly states its purpose.
